    JACKIEJOYJACKIEJOY Posts: 802 Member
    Open Origin by clicking on the Origin icon, not the game. Click on the word Origin in the upper left. Select play offline. Exit Origin, disconnect from the internet and then start the game. You should be good to go.

    BreeSashaBreeSasha Posts: 638 Member
    So I got the patch to fix the game which did fix the issue with the game crashing but now the game is super slow; my sims don't respond when I tell them to eat or go do something. They just stand there, almost frozen, but the time is still going. It's also slow to switch between simmies in a household. Their reactions/moodlets are also slow to register. I had my sim play video games (because her fun was low), then she went to eat. After she got off the video game, her moodlet was white (fine). While she's eating, her aura was purple for focused. When I check the moodlet, it says she was focused from a good gaming session but she was actively eating and should have had that moodlet earlier. It's weird, I didn't have these problems prior to the hot fix patch today.

    Don't worry about avoiding the update. If you hit the loading screen problem after the update, repair the game in Origin.

    I would prefer to avoid it for now, is there a way?

    You could play in offline mode


    If I turn off my computer WiFi will that allow me to open origin without the patch updating

    Go into origin, settings on the left and scroll down to go off line. That's how I've been avoiding the patch update for now. You don't have to physically turn off your whole wifi.
    And like smurfy77 above said, make sure you have automatic updates turned off.
